Bachelor Mountain
 
Director_ Yu Guangyi
 
China 2011 100min DV Color feature
Review

The title refers to a mountain of single men, a by-product of the surge of capital and social change. San Liangzi, a divorced man, has long fancied Wang Meizi, one of a few single women in his village, but his love for her seems hopeless. This film is the final piece of the director´s “Hometown Trilogy.”

DIRECTOR
Yu Guangyi 
YU Guangyi (1961, China) studied at the China Academy of Art in Hangzhou and worked as woodcut print artist. In 2004 he started making independent documentaries. His debut Timber Gang (2007) was awarded ex aequo the Director's Award at the Asian Festival of 1st Films in 2007 with its other English title The Last Lumberjacks. His second film, Survival Song (2008), also won prizes in Tokyo and Seoul. Yu Guangyi has already completed the three films in his “Hometown Trilogy” and is currently at work on a new documentary.
